In 2022 a particularly memorable exhibition featured Mike Rachlis and Kai Mccall. Their show “Vandalized History & Portraits in Style” was a sensation. It even got a virtual tour. This 3D Matterport tour allowed hundreds more people to experience the art. Even after the physical exhibition closed. Each artwork in the virtual tour is meticulously detailed. You see the size the media the artist and a purchase option.
